The BOB Sport Utility

The BOB Sport utility is the ideal stroller to use if you want to get off the beaten track and work out. The jogging stroller has pneumatic knobby tires that are perfect for trail runs, and hand brakes that let you manage the downhills. It also has a top-of-the-line suspension system, a two-step folding design, and an enormous cargo basket. It can also be used with an infant car seat if you buy the right adapters.

The main flaw of this jogging stroller is its weight and folded dimensions. It weighs 25 pounds and folds to 17,850 cubic inches, which is the average for this category. The size of its footprint means it's not ideal for tight turns or small trunk spaces, but it has a small handle at the back of the basket that can be pulled to fold it into a compact, flat position.

Despite its size, this stroller remains easy to navigate. The front wheel is fitted with a locking mechanism which allows you to switch between locked and normal mode. The handlebar can be adjusted to different parent heights. It comes with a spacious seat which can be reclined to almost flat and a large vinyl peekaboo window.

The Sport Utility also scored a 9 out of 10 for its exceptional quality. It has a strong frame made of aluminum with strong connections, no rough edges and no sloppy stitching. It also has adjustable dampers, which aid in smooth rolling performance.

The Sport Utility stroller, like the other BOBs reviewed in this review, has optional car seat adapters. This lets you use it with a variety of car seats for infants. It took us 5:24 minutes in our tests to put together the stroller from packing it up to getting it ready to go. It was easy enough to do, but you'll require a Philips head screwdriver to complete the task. The included manual is clear and well-organized. The Baby Trend Expedition

This jogger is designed with safety, style and convenience as its main goals. It has a tray for parents that has 2 cup holders and covered storage, as well as an infant tray that can be swung away and has two cup holders. The adjustable canopy, with its peek-aboo windows and an extra-wide ergonomically-shaped handle, provides comfort for both parents. The lockable front swivel wheel can be locked for jogging, and unlocked to stroll. The large storage basket is ideal for storing the essential items you need to travel with.

Consumer Reports' Strollers test program confirms that the Baby Trend Expedition Jogger is a good value for its price and has higher scores than most of its rivals across various categories. The 5-point harness, folding, unfolding and adjusting backrests, engaging 3 wheel all terrain pram brakes, and infant car seat installation and removal (only compatible models) are all included. It's a simple design, with a single-handed recline that is deep enough for napping. However the canopy cover, which ratchets, isn't always easy to fix. It also takes nearly 8 minutes to set up and the instructions are confusing, with several languages mixed together and difficult-to-read illustrations.

The only negative about this jogger is that it does not have a suspension system, so the ride may be bumpier than some of the other all terrain travel stroller-terrain strollers we've tested. This might cause discomfort for toddlers, especially if they are on the close to a nap. The air-filled wheels are great, but they don't provide as much cushioning as rubber tires on strollers that are more expensive.

This is a great option for those who don't run frequently but would like to move freely over grass or gravel without worrying about obstacles like curbs or other obstructions. It's also a great choice for families with a limited space since it folds into a compact size. It's lighter than many of the other joggers we've tried and fits into spaces that some full-size strollers don't.

Another advantage is that it's more easy to carry and lift than the bulkier Joggers we've tested. This can be important if you have to lift it in and out of the trunk of your vehicle regularly or if you're constantly moving.
